Product Description
The WD NU-562-214-0003 is engineered for environments where speed and reliability are paramount. It utilizes the SATA (Serial ATA) interface, specifically the 6Gb/s revision, which provides significantly higher data transfer rates compared to older SATA standards. This allows for quicker access to data, reducing bottlenecks in systems that handle large files or high transaction volumes. The drive's 250GB capacity is optimized for applications that require rapid data retrieval rather than massive bulk storage. With a spindle speed of 10000 RPM, this hard drive offers superior performance over drives operating at lower speeds like 5400 or 7200 RPM. The faster rotation of the platters means that the read/write heads spend less time seeking data, resulting in lower latency and higher throughput. This makes the NU-562-214-0003 an excellent choice for servers, workstations, and high-performance computing tasks where responsiveness is critical. The inclusion of a 64MB cache further enhances performance by storing frequently accessed data closer to the drive's controller. This buffer helps to smooth out data transfers and reduce the workload on the system's main memory. The 3.5-inch form factor ensures compatibility with standard drive bays in most server and desktop chassis, making it a versatile option for upgrades or new builds demanding speed and efficiency.
